Shadow of the Six Samurai - Shien

With all the exams over and realisation of flunking everything finally settling in, I decided that the TCG exclusive Six Sam card needs some attention.

All I can say is, why didn't they make it as broken as Tour Guide?

Nah, the last thing Six Sams need is another support to give all their haters the reason to call them "autopilot" and lalalalaaa.... Six Sams are one of the strongest balanced archetypes out there, period. What the new Exceed does is give them a much needed Bushido counter producer.

Previously, the only way to produce Bushido counters outside of wasting hand cards was through Shi'en, which, after a couple of ban lists is not reliable anymore. With the new Exceed, this essentially takes up the spot of the second Shi'en in the Extra Deck that we used to play. Albeit having a heavily nerfed effect.

Another thing to note is that since Shadow is a Shi'en monster, it can be revived by the Gateway remove 6 effect, and will give an additional 2 counters upon summon, making it a 4 counter Monster Reborn in itself.

Furthurmore, its 2500ATK is relatively good, and the effect can cause some drastic plays that could force an OTK or even and opponent mistake. Being able to use its effect during the opponent's turn is no joke.

All in all, I'd use it, mainly for the Six Samurai in the name to produce counters and keep Maga live. Also, with the 2500ATK it gets over Ragia which is why people run Hope in Six Sam anyway, so this could alsonserve as a Hope replacement.

Good eff, good ATK, easy summoning, and Six Sam in name, worth it.
